Air India Express to launch Coimbatore-Bengaluru flights from Oct 25

COIMBATORE: Air India Express will launch two daily flight services between Coimbatore and Bengaluru from October 25, taking the total number of daily flights between the two cities to five, according to a Daily Thanthi report.

Coimbatore International Airport currently operates 28 flights a day, connecting the city with domestic destinations including Chennai, Bengaluru, New Delhi and Mumbai, besides international destinations such as Sharjah, Abu Dhabi and Dubai.

Air India Express had recently introduced two daily flights between Coimbatore and Mumbai from September 1. Following this, the airline is now set to add two daily services between Coimbatore and Bengaluru.

Coimbatore-Bengaluru flight timings

According to the report, the first flight will depart from Coimbatore at 9.10 am and arrive at Bengaluru airport at 10.05 am. The second flight will leave Coimbatore at 9.50 pm and reach Bengaluru at 10.45 pm.

In the return direction, a flight will depart from Bengaluru at 7.20 am and arrive in Coimbatore at 8.25 am. Another service will leave Bengaluru at 7.10 pm and reach Coimbatore at 8.15 pm.

Air India Express officials said the new services will begin in the first phase from October 25, with full-scale operations scheduled to commence from November 1.

With the addition of these services, passengers travelling between Coimbatore and Bengaluru will have more flight options. The five daily flights on the route will be operated jointly by IndiGo and Air India Express.
